The Aircraft Family Concepts for an Advanced Technology Regional Aircraft

DESIGN, CONSTRUCTION, MAINTENANCE, 2022
The aim of this work is to make a feasibility study of the aircraft family concepts using a combined Hybrid Laminar Flow Control - Variable Camber Wing (HLFC-VCW) for a high subsonic Advanced Technology Regional Aircraft (ATRA). The prediction of ATRA’s performance used computational fluid dynamic and empirical methods.

Computation of Controllability Regions for Unstable Aircraft Dynamics

Journal of Guidance, Control, and Dynamics, 2004
This output describes an approach based on geometrical and optimisation principles that resulted in efficient software tools for computation of null controllability region of unstable dynamical systems. The software toolset, “Stabcalcs” has been created and tested on several flight dynamics applications and delivered to DERA/QinetiQ Ltd.

Regional fanjet aircraft optimization studies

Journal of Aircraft, 1991
This article illustrates the use of optimization methods in the development of a new regional aircraft. These aircraft are more sensitive to changes in operational requirements than other types due, in part, to their high zero-fuel weight ratio.
